In der modernen Robotik spielt die präzise Positions- und Bewegungssteuerung eine entscheidende Rolle. Schrittmotoren werden aufgrund ihrer einfachen Ansteuerung und hohen Wiederholgenauigkeit häufig in Robotersystemen eingesetzt. Dennoch besitzen sie eine grundlegende Schwäche: Ohne zusätzliche Rückmeldung weiß das System nicht sicher, ob der Motor tatsächlich jeden Schritt korrekt ausgeführt hat. Hier kommt der Schrittmotor Encoder ins Spiel. Die Entwicklung eines geeigneten Encoders kann die Zuverlässigkeit und Präzision von Robotikanwendungen erheblich verbessern.
![]()
Ein Encoder ist ein Sensor, der die Drehbewegung einer Motorwelle in elektrische Signale umwandelt. Diese Signale liefern Informationen über Position, Geschwindigkeit und Drehrichtung. Für Schrittmotoren werden häufig inkrementelle Encoder eingesetzt, die eine bestimmte Anzahl von Impulsen pro Umdrehung erzeugen. Durch das Zählen dieser Impulse kann die Steuerung exakt bestimmen, wie weit sich der Motor bewegt hat.
Bei der Entwicklung eines Schrittmotor Encoders für Robotikanwendungen müssen mehrere Faktoren berücksichtigt werden. Einer der wichtigsten Aspekte ist die Auflösung. Je höher die Impulszahl pro Umdrehung, desto präziser kann die Position des Motors bestimmt werden. Allerdings steigt mit höherer Auflösung auch die Anforderungen an die Elektronik und die Signalverarbeitung. Daher muss ein ausgewogenes Verhältnis zwischen Genauigkeit und Systemkomplexität gefunden werden.
Ein weiterer wichtiger Punkt ist die mechanische Integration. Der Encoder muss stabil und exakt mit der Motorwelle verbunden sein, ohne zusätzliche Vibrationen oder Spiel zu verursachen. In der Praxis wird häufig eine optische oder magnetische Encoderlösung verwendet. Optische Encoder arbeiten mit einer Lichtquelle und einer kodierten Scheibe, während magnetische Encoder Magnetfelder und Hall-Sensoren nutzen. Magnetische Systeme sind oft robuster gegenüber Staub, Feuchtigkeit und Vibrationen, was sie für viele industrielle Robotikanwendungen besonders geeignet macht.
Neben der Hardware spielt auch die Software eine entscheidende Rolle. Die Encoder-Signale müssen von einem Mikrocontroller oder einer Steuerungseinheit verarbeitet werden. Durch geeignete Algorithmen kann das System beispielsweise Schrittverluste erkennen und korrigieren. Dadurch wird ein sogenannter „Closed-Loop-Betrieb“ möglich, bei dem der Schrittmotor ähnlich präzise wie ein Servomotor arbeitet, jedoch oft kostengünstiger bleibt.
Darüber hinaus sollte bei der Entwicklung auch auf Energieeffizienz und Echtzeitfähigkeit geachtet werden. In mobilen Robotersystemen ist ein geringer Energieverbrauch entscheidend, während in industriellen Anwendungen eine schnelle und stabile Signalverarbeitung notwendig ist.
Zusammenfassend lässt sich sagen, dass die Entwicklung eines Schrittmotor Encoders ein wichtiger Schritt zur Verbesserung der Leistungsfähigkeit moderner Robotersysteme ist. Durch die Kombination aus präziser Sensorik, robuster mechanischer Konstruktion und intelligenter Signalverarbeitung können Schrittmotoren deutlich zuverlässiger und vielseitiger eingesetzt werden. Dies eröffnet neue Möglichkeiten für Anwendungen in der industriellen Automatisierung, in Servicerobotern und in der Forschung.
限會員,要發表迴響,請先登入


